What is Concrete Cube Testing?

Concrete Cube Testing is a laboratory procedure used to measure the compressive strength of hardened concrete.


Fresh concrete is poured into a standard cube mould, compacted, cured under controlled conditions, and then subjected to increasing compressive load inside a Compression Testing Machine (CTM) until failure occurs.


The maximum load sustained before failure determines the compressive strength of the concrete.



The formula used is

Compressive Strength (N/mm²) = Failure Load (N) ÷ Loaded Area (mm²)


For a standard 150 mm × 150 mm × 150 mm concrete cube

Cube Face Area = 150 × 150 = 22,500 mm²

This value is compared with the specified concrete grade (M20, M25, M30, etc.) to verify structural quality.



Why is Concrete Cube Testing Important?

Concrete cube testing plays a critical role in construction quality assurance.


1. Verifies Concrete Strength

• The primary purpose of the test is to confirm whether the concrete has achieved the required compressive strength specified in the structural design.

• This ensures the building can safely withstand design loads throughout its lifespan.


2. Ensures Structural Safety

• Weak concrete may develop cracks, excessive deflection, or structural failure.

• Cube testing helps identify poor-quality concrete before it becomes part of a completed structure.


3. Quality Control

Concrete strength can vary because of


• Incorrect water-cement ratio

• Poor mixing

• Low-quality aggregates

• Improper compaction

• Insufficient curing

• Material contamination


Regular cube testing ensures every concrete batch meets project specifications.


4. Compliance with Standards

Concrete cube testing is required by national and international standards, including


• IS Codes

• ASTM Standards

• BS EN Standards


Construction consultants and government agencies often require cube test reports before approving structural work.


5. Detects Construction Errors

Cube testing helps identify issues such as


• Honeycombing

• Segregation

• Excessive water content

• Poor vibration

• Improper batching


Detecting these problems early reduces costly repairs.


6. Improves Project Quality

Consistent testing enables contractors to maintain high construction quality and avoid structural defects.



What is a Compression Testing Machine (CTM)?

A Compression Testing Machine (CTM) is a laboratory machine used to determine the compressive strength of concrete cube specimens.


The machine applies increasing compressive force until the concrete cube fractures.


The highest load recorded represents the failure load used to calculate compressive strength.


CTMs are widely used in


• Civil Engineering Laboratories

• Ready Mix Concrete Plants

• Construction Companies

• Government Testing Laboratories

• Universities

• Infrastructure Projects

Standard Cube Mould Sizes

The most common cube mould sizes include


• 150 × 150 × 150 mm - Standard concrete testing

• 100 × 100 × 100 mm - Small aggregate concrete

• 50 × 50 × 50 mm - Laboratory research


Among these, the 150 mm PVC Cube Mould is the industry standard for routine concrete compressive strength testing.



Step-by-Step Concrete Cube Testing Procedure


Step 1 – Clean the PVC Cube Mould

• Before casting, clean the mould thoroughly.

• Remove any dirt, old cement, or debris.


Step 2 – Apply Mould Oil

• Apply a thin layer of mould release oil to the internal surfaces.

• This ensures easy demoulding without damaging cube edges.


Step 3 – Prepare Fresh Concrete

• Mix concrete according to the approved mix design while maintaining the correct water-cement ratio.


Step 4 – Fill the Cube Mould

• Fill the PVC Cube Mould in equal layers.

• Depending on laboratory practice, fill in two or three layers.


Step 5 – Compact Each Layer

Compaction removes trapped air.


This can be done using

• Tamping Rod

• Vibration Table


Proper compaction increases concrete density and improves test accuracy.


Step 6 – Finish the Surface

Level the top surface using a trowel.


Mark the cube with

• Casting Date

• Sample Number

• Mix Grade

• Batch Identification


Step 7 – Initial Setting

• Keep the mould undisturbed for approximately 24 hours.

• Maintain suitable temperature and humidity.


Step 8 – Demould the Cube

• After 24 hours, carefully remove the PVC mould.

• Inspect cube edges for defects.


Step 9 – Water Curing

Immerse the concrete cubes in clean water until testing.


Standard curing durations include

• 7 Days – Early Strength

• 14 Days – Intermediate Strength (optional)

• 28 Days – Final Design Strength



Compression Testing Procedure Using CTM

After curing

• Remove the cube from water.

• Wipe excess surface moisture.

• Position the cube centrally inside the CTM.

• Apply load gradually until failure.

• Record the maximum load.

• Calculate compressive strength.



Importance of Accurate Cube Dimensions

The compressive strength calculation depends directly on the loaded surface area.


Even a small dimensional error can significantly affect the calculated strength.


Therefore, precision cube moulds are essential for reliable results.
